    I'm really hoping for a port of BlackBerry sms built into Priv Hub. For the first few days of using the Priv i kept the hub disabled. Basically for 2 reasons-
    1) both my personal Gmail account as well as my Google Apps for business account have no push abilities in the hub which just doesn't work for me (especially for work).

    2) the hub having to open up another text app just to view is text is really irritating. No texting app with the exception of chomp will default back to the main conversation list upon closing. So when using textra or messenger i have to manually tab back to get to the main conversation list every time.

    I solved problem 1 by disabling Gmail and setting up my Outlook email in the hub instead which pushes. Then setting up my Google Apps account up through exchange which then pushes my work Gmail.

    Problem 2 is currently unsolvable and made more bearable by using chomp but still less that ideal.

    It's clear after switching to push accounts in the hub that BlackBerry did a great job with the email app. The lack of Gmail push is Google fault and not BlackBerrys.

    I just wonder how difficult it would be to build sms into the hub app. They did it with email and there are no api restrictions i know of that would prevent them from building there own sms app into it. This added functionality would easy improve the hub experience and make it at least 70% as useful as it was on my z10 with regards to what i use it for.

    Does anyone else feel my pain? And does anyone know if a BlackBerry sms app is in the works?

    Imap push is not reliable. Some times its instant and others it the 15 minute poll time. I have 15 employees and once a month im on call to nearly 70 folks. I need reliable instant email that BlackBerry used to be known for and exchange still is (this is the only thing i miss about BIS). When setting up exchange or even a free outlook account, push is displayed in the frequency option. However with gmail and Google Apps accounts 15 is the highest frequency and push isn't even in the frequency options.
